Troubleshooting Common Issues in Industrial Pan Drying

Many difficulties might occur during this dish drying system in the manufacturing setting. Frequently, irregular moisture content is noticed, generally due to poor atmosphere flow or faulty conveyors. A further common concern concerns patchy discoloration, that points to excessive temperature or uneven temperature spread. Finally, intermittent blocking within the trays may stem from deposit on evaporated material, necessitating frequent servicing.

Selecting the Right Processing Pan Dehydrator for Your Application

Selecting a suitable industrial tray dryer requires thorough consideration of several factors . The type of material being dehydrated significantly impacts the required warmth and residence time. Moreover , output capacity is a critical determinant; a limited batch might benefit from a smaller unit, while substantial volumes demand a heavy-duty setup . Ultimately, heat efficiency and servicing costs should be reviewed to confirm a economical and dependable investment.

Boosting Efficiency: Maintenance Tips for Pan Dryers

To ensure maximum efficiency from your pan dryer, regular upkeep is completely vital. Ignoring even problems can lead to considerable stoppages and increased operating costs.

  • Completely clean any material from the pan surfaces after each batch.
  • Inspect bearings for wear and grease them as needed.
  • Observe the condition of gaskets and repair them immediately if escapes are found.
  • Confirm exhaust flow and address any obstructions.
By sticking to these straightforward guidelines, you can maximize the life of your pan dryer and sustain processing within desired parameters.
